Default location of low range lite switch?

2001 Dodge 1500 4WD Offroad Option
5.9L, Auto, 231-D Xfer (2.78 ratio?), Limited Slip w/4.10 Gears

Everything works fine except the Low Range Lite doesn't lite up when the truck is in 4-Lo. The actual bulb tests OK. I have the factory manuals and an old Haynes manual, which have the wiring diagrams, but no drawing of the actual switch and its location (somewhere on the transfer case, I assume?). I cannot get my hands & arms in all the places I'd like to check without beginning some disassembly, which I'd like to avoid. So I'm hoping someone can just tell me where the switch/actuator/or whatever is located and what it looks like, I'd certainly be grateful.
